A transmission type projection screen is provided with a transparent film attached adhesively to only opaque or shading parts formed on top surfaces of ridges provided on the front surface of a lens sheet. The lens sheet is provided on its rear surface with a plurality of lenses for condensing light projected by a light source. The shading parts do not receive the light condensed by the plurality of lenses. The film protects the front surface of the lens sheet of the screen, and prevents scattering of the lens sheet in fragments when the lens sheet is cracked.

In a projection screen for a rear projection type television set, three lens sheets are arranged in the order of a lenticular lens sheet, a linear Fresnel lens sheet, and a circular Fresnel lens sheet when seen from a viewer's side toward a projector tube. As compared with the arrangement in which the linear and circular Fresnel lens sheets are exchanged with each other, it is possible to obtain a higher brightness and a more uniform brightness, and color uniformity in the picture plane. Further, when the light incident surface of the linear Fresnel lens sheet is matted, it is possible to eliminate white bands (seen from the viewer's side) effectively.

A catalyst composition having a composition represented by the formula:A.sub.0.1-4 B.sub.0.02-1 Mo.sub.12 Bi.sub.0.5-10 Fe.sub.0.5-10 Na.sub.0-3 P.sub.0-2 O.sub.gwherein A is at least one element selected from the group consisting of cerium, lanthanum, neodium, praseodium, samarium, europium and gadrinium, B is at least one element selected from the group consisting of potassium, rubidium and cesium, and g is the number of oxygen atoms required to satisfy the valence requirements of the other elements present, and supported on silica.

Grains of a totally porous, hydroxyl group-containing, nonionic and hydrophilic synthetic cross-linked polymer having alcoholic hydroxyl and ether groups as main hydrophilic groups and having as a main skeleton a chemical structure including carbon atoms, hydrogen atoms and oxygen atoms bonded through single bonds, said synthetic polymer having a hydroxyl group density of 1 to 15 milliequivalents/g, a specific surface area of 5 to 1000 m.sup.2 /g and a water regain of 0.3 to 3.0 g/g. Such grains have been found to be a packing material or gel for high speed, aqueous gel permeation chromatography. The packing material of the present invention which comprises grains of a hydroxyl group-containing nonionic and hydrophilic synthetic cross-linked polymer has a chemical structure obtained by reacting a totally porous, hydroxyl group-containing, nonionic polymer with a polyfunctional substance capable of reacting with the hydroxyl groups of said polymer while forming cross-linking ether groups.

A magnetic recording structure comprises (1) a substrate having an outer surface, and (2) a laminar magnetic recording piece disposed adjacent to at least one part of the outer surface of the substrate, the recording piece comprising a magnetic layer, a color layer and a non-magnetic metal deposition layer interposed between the magnetic layer and the color layer, the magnetic layer being closer to the substrate than the color layer.The non-magnetic metal deposition layer disposed on the magnetic layer has high hiding power and, even in the form of an extremely thin layer, can effectively hide the color of the magnetic material.Accordingly, this magnetic recording structure can be produced with a surface of a beautiful color without impairing its magnetic characteristics.

A novel three-component type acrylic resin composition comprising a C.sub.3 -C.sub.8 alkyl ester of acrylic acid, methyl acrylate and methyl methacrylate in a specific ratio. Such composition can be readily molded into a shaped article which is excellent in solvent resistance even upon being fabricated. The composition of the present invention is also featured by its good heat distortion temperature and mechanical strength, as compared to the conventional acrylic resin composition.

An antiglare film that includes light-transmitting substrate and a diffusion layer, the diffusion layer having a surface roughness on a surface thereof and being formed on at least one side of the light-transmitting substrate, wherein the diffusion layer contains a cured product of a binder component and organic fine particles (A) dispersed in the cured product of the binder component, and the following expression is satisfied: |NA−nb|>|nA−nb|>0 where NA represents a refractive index of the organic fine particles (A) before the organic fine particles (A) are introduced into the diffusion layer, nA represents a refractive index of the organic fine particles (A) in the diffusion layer, and nb represents a refractive index in the cured product of the binder component.

The present invention provides an antiglare film having an excellent antiglare property and being capable of suitably preventing an occurrence of scintillation and a decrease in contrast. The film includes a light-transmitting substrate and a diffusion layer. The diffusion layer has a surface roughness and is formed on at least one side of the light-transmitting substrate, wherein the diffusion layer contains organic fine particles (A), organic fine particles (B), and a cured product of a binder component, and satisfies the expressions: (1) rA>rB; (2) ΔA CB/CA, where CA and CB represent a content ratio of the organic fine particles (A) or the organic fine particles (B) in the diffusion layer, respectively, rA and rB represent an average particle size thereof, respectively, and ΔA and ΔB represent a refractive index thereof relative to the cured product of the binder component, respectively.

The present invention provides a gas barrier film having high barrier properties, folding/bending resistance and smoothness and excellent cutting suitability, and also provides an organic photoelectric conversion element equipped with the gas barrier film. The gas barrier film is characterized by having a gas barrier layer unit (5) on a side face of at least one surface of a base material (2), wherein the gas barrier layer unit (5) comprises a first barrier layer (3) formed by a chemical vapor deposition method and a second barrier layer (4) formed by applying a silicon compound onto the first barrier layer (3) to form a coating film and modifying the coating film, and wherein the second barrier layer (4) has an unmodified region (4B) on a side facing the base material and a modified region (4A) on a side facing the front layer of the film.
